Seat back drops down on the tabs at the top of the panel. You have to push in on the to engage them. I think it is has 2 loops coming down off the spring metal frame at the bottom that are bolted to the back panel. Mine never had those bolts installed at the bottom, but I think that's the setup. The seat bottom is pushed in under the seat back. Has loops coming down that hook on the pieces welded to the floor pan. It's a tight fit, really have to force the seat bottom and the loops to the back to engage them in the hooks on the floor. That will lock it all together. The metal filler panels on the sides of seat back are screwed to the side, not the seat. The plastic side panels have the armrest and ash tray molded in, they fill the gap between the side metal that holds the window mechanism and the seat bottom.

All of the above applies to a 70 but I believe at least the seats mount the same on the earlier version Chevelles, pre-68.
